How Much WWE Executives Makes In A Year ?
Looking at the leaked information here is how the pay scale works in the excutives of WWE, starting from Chairman and CEO Vince McMahon to other executives.
  1. Vince McMahon ( CEO ) Salary In 2014 – $1,184,500
  2. George Barrios (Financial and Strategic Officer)  – $800,000
  3. Kevin Dunn (Producer)  – $800,000
  4. Michael Luisi (WWE Studios President ) – $700,000
  5. Paul “Triple H” Levesque (vise president live events, talent) – $550,000 + $1,000,000 in yearly talen contract and of course his WWE ring & match appearance which details are given below.

WWE Wrestler Contract & Basic Salary + Bonuses:

Every wrestler who signs up for WWE signs a professional contract with the company stating number of years, basic salary plus bonuses and some other clauses conerning factors like release, retirement, injury layouts etc. The basic yearly salary is the downside guarantee payments, bonuses, and merchandise shares.

Incomes From PPV Events:

Some bigger names like John Cena etc enjoy PPV revenue share with the company and they make alot of money than the other stars in the roster. The PPV income figures are impossible to know because WWE never disclose this information. So we will only be taking a look at how WWE compensate their stars in basic salary and other clauses.
